How Performance Fishing Shirts Protect You from the Sun

There's nothing quite like the serene bliss of casting a line into shimmering waters, the thrill of a tug on the reel, and the satisfaction of a successful catch. Yet, for anglers, prolonged hours on the water come with a hidden risk: harmful ultraviolet (UV) radiation. The waters surface reflects around 80% of UV rays, meaning anglers face a double dose of exposurefrom above and bouncing off the surface.

Water reflects UV rays, significantly increasing exposure and the risk of sunburn, premature aging, and even skin cancer. Just a few severe sunburns can increase your lifetime risk of melanoma, the deadliest form of skin cancer. Understanding the enemy, UV radiation, is crucial. The sun emits three types of UV rays: UVA, UVB, and UVC. While UVC is absorbed by the Earths atmosphere, UVA and UVB penetrate through, causing damage to the skins layers.


  • UVA Rays: Penetrate deep into the skin, contributing to wrinkles, sunspots, and long-term skin damage.
  • UVB Rays: Responsible for sunburns, they damage the skins outer layers and are a key factor in the development of skin cancer.

What Makes a Fishing Shirt Performance Wear?

How Performance Fishing Shirts Protect You from the Sun 1

Performance fishing shirts arent ordinary appareltheyre engineered to tackle the unique challenges of life on the water. While a standard cotton T-shirt offers minimal protection (UPF 510), performance shirts are designed with advanced fabrics and features that provide robust UV protection and enhanced comfort and functionality.

Key attributes include:

  • UPF (Ultraviolet Protection Factor) Ratings: The cornerstone of sun protection in clothing. A UPF 50+ rating means just 1/50th (2%) of UV radiation passes through the fabric.

  • Moisture-Wicking Fabrics: These materials pull moisture away from the skin to the fabrics surface, where it evaporates quickly, keeping you dry in sweltering heat.

  • Breathable Materials: These materials ensure all-day comfort by allowing air to pass through the fabric, preventing overheating.

    Durability: Resilient materials like nylon, polyester, and rayon withstand harsh environments, ensuring longevity.

  • Functional Design: Practical features such as pockets, hoods, and ventilation enhance usability and comfort.


UPF Protection: The Science Behind Sun-Safe Fabric

The most critical feature of a performance fishing shirt is its UPF rating. Unlike sunscreen, which requires reapplication, UPF measures how effectively fabric blocks UV radiation.

  • Tight Weave: Fabrics with a dense weave leave fewer gaps for UV rays to penetrate.
  • Specialized Treatments: Some materials are infused with UV-absorbing chemicals like titanium dioxide or zinc oxide during manufacturing.
  • Synthetic Fibers: Materials like nylon, polyester, and rayon inherently offer higher UPF than natural fibers like cotton.

Real-World Impact: Imagine spending eight hours on a boat wearing a UPF 50+ shirt. Even in peak sunlight, your skin would receive the equivalent UV exposure of just 16 minutes without protection. This drastically reduces the risk of burns and long-term damage.

Bonus Tip: Look for shirts with certified UPF ratings (e.g., rated by ASTM International standards) to ensure authenticity.


Moisture-Wicking and Breathability: Staying Cool Under Pressure

Sun protection alone isnt enough. Anglers need shirts that combat sweat and heat without compromising comfort. Performance shirts achieve this through:

  • Hydrophobic Fabrics: Materials like polyester pull moisture away from the skin to the fabrics surface, where it evaporates quickly.
  • Mesh Panels and Ventilation: Strategically placed mesh underarms or along the back enhance airflow.
  • Odor Resistance: Antimicrobial treatments inhibit bacteria growth, keeping shirts fresh even after hours of wear.

Why It Matters: Cotton absorbs sweat, leaving you damp and uncomfortable. In contrast, moisture-wicking shirts maintain a dry microclimate against your skin, preventing irritation and chafing. Plus, evaporation helps regulate body temperature, making these shirts a lifesaver during midsummer fishing trips.


Durability: Built to Weather the Elements

Fishing environments are notoriously harshthink saltwater spray, rocky shorelines, and sharp tackle. Performance shirts are crafted from resilient materials that endure:

  • Abrasion-Resistant Fabrics: Reinforced stitching and rugged materials like ripstop nylon withstand snags and scrapes.
  • Fade Resistance: UV-stable dyes maintain color vibrancy despite prolonged sun exposure.
  • Quick-Drying: Many shirts dry in minutes, essential for impromptu dips or sudden squalls.

Pro Insight: Some brands integrate cooling technologies (e.g., phase-change materials) that absorb heat when temperatures rise, offering an extra layer of comfort.


Functional Design: Features Tailored for Anglers

Performance shirts arent just about protectiontheyre designed with the practical needs of anglers in mind:

  • Expandable Collars: To shield the neck, a common sunburn hotspot.
  • Hidden Hoods: Stowable in a collar for instant head and face protection.
  • Multiple Pockets: Secure storage for tools, lures, or a phone.
  • UPF-Factor Zippers: YKK UPF zippers on front closures or ventilation flaps add sun-safe convenience.
  • Roll-Up Sleeves: Convert long sleeves into short sleeves with a few flicks, offering versatility as conditions change.

Example Scenario: A bass fisherman casting from a kayak might appreciate a shirt with a hood to block glare, a zippered chest pocket for pliers, and mesh-lined underarms to stay cool during repeated casts.


Debunking Myths About Sun-Protective Clothing

Despite their benefits, misconceptions about performance shirts persist:

  • Myth 1: Dark Colors Are Always Better.
    While darker hues generally offer higher UPF, modern fabrics achieve high ratings in light colors too, which are ideal for hot climates.

  • Myth 2: Wet Shirts Provide No Protection.
    True, wet fabric often loses UPF effectivenessbut some performance shirts are treated to retain UPF even when damp.

  • Myth 3: All UPF Shirts Feel Stiff or Hot.
    Advances in textile technology ensure todays shirts are lightweight, soft, and breathable. Many feel cooler than traditional cotton.


Choosing the Right Shirt: Key Considerations

Not all performance fishing shirts are created equal. Heres how to pick the perfect one:

  1. UPF Rating: Aim for UPF 30+ (good) or UPF 50+ (excellent).
  2. Fit: Opt for a relaxed cut to allow airflow and range of motion.
  3. Climate: Lightweight, breathable shirts suit tropical zones; long sleeves with thermal lining work for cool mornings.
  4. Style Preferences: Decide between button-ups, pullovers, hoodies, or hooded zip-ups.
  5. Extra Features: Prioritize hoods, pockets, or insect-repellent finishes based on your needs.

Caring for Your Investment

Maximize your shirts lifespan and effectiveness with proper care:


  • Follow Washing Instructions: Harsh detergents or high heat can degrade UV treatments.
  • Avoid Fabric Softeners: These can clog moisture-wicking fibers.
  • Retreat When Needed: Some shirts benefit from reapplying UV-protective sprays (e.g., Insect Shield) over time.

Beyond the Shirt: Building a Sun-Smart Fishing Routine

While performance shirts are foundational, combine them with other sun protection measures:

  • UPF Hats and Gloves: Broad-brimmed hats and fingerless gloves add coverage.
  • Polarized Sunglasses: Reduce glare and protect eye health.
  • Water-Resistant Sunscreen: Apply to exposed areas like the face and hands.
  • Hydration: Staying hydrated helps regulate body temperature.
